选择合适的编程语言对于新手来说至关重要。在这个快速变化的科技时代,不同的编程语言具有不同的特点和应用领域,深入了解这些特点能够帮助我们做出明智的选择。本文将探讨新手在选择编程语言时应考虑的几个关键因素,以及目前市场上热门语言的趋势。

一、个人兴趣和目标
选择编程语言时,首先要明确自己的兴趣和学习目标。如果对网页开发感兴趣,JavaScript是一个极佳的起点;而如果希望顺利进入数据分析领域,Python则非常受欢迎。根据个人兴趣和未来职业定位选择合适的语言,会让学习过程更有动力和乐趣。
二、市场需求和未来发展
了解当前市场需求同样重要。招聘平台上的数据可以为我们提供选择编程语言的重要参考。例如,近年来Python和Java持续受到欢迎,AI和大数据领域的快速扩展使得这两种语言的需求也随之攀升。在选择编程语言时,关注行业趋势和未来的技术发展,可以更好地规划自己的职业发展轨迹。
三、学习资源和社区支持
编程入门时,丰富的学习资源和活跃的社区支持至关重要。新手可以通过网上课程、书籍和论坛等多种方式学习。选择那些有广泛社区支持的语言,如JavaScript、Python和Java,将能更方便地获得帮助和解决问题。良好的社区氛围不仅能提升学习体验,还能让新手迅速融入编程世界。
四、编程语言的易学性
对许多新手来说,编程语言的易学性往往是选择的重要因素。Python因其语法简洁,逻辑清晰,受到众多新手的青睐。而C++虽然功能强大,但由于其复杂性和较高的学习门槛,可能会令初学者感到畏惧。对刚入门的编程者而言,选择一门相对容易上手的语言,能帮助他们更快地建立信心。
五、项目类型和应用场景
不同的编程语言在使用场景上有明显差异。例如,C在游戏开发、尤其是使用Unity引擎时表现突出,而R语言则在统计分析与数据可视化方面更具优势。根据自己希望参与的项目类型和应用场景,选择相应的编程语言,将有助于实现更高效的开发。
编程是一项充满挑战的技能,而选择正确的语言可以让学习过程更加顺利与愉快。希望上述因素能够帮助新手在浩瀚的编程世界中找到属于自己的航向。
常见问题解答
1. 为什么要选择适合的编程语言?
选择适合的编程语言能够提升学习效率,增强职业竞争力,帮助您更好地适应市场需求。
2. 哪些编程语言适合初学者?
Python、JavaScript和Ruby等语言因其易于理解的语法和广泛的应用场景,适合初学者学习。
3. 如何了解市场对某种语言的需求?
可以通过招聘网站、行业报告、技术论坛等渠道了解目前市场上对各种编程语言的需求情况。
4. 学习编程语言的推荐资源有哪些?
网络课程(如Coursera、edX)、编程书籍(如《Python编程:从入门到实践》)、开源项目和在线编程社区(如Stack Overflow)都是很好的学习资源。
5. 编程语言是否有未来发展潜力?
一些语言如Python和 Java,在AI、大数据等前沿领域持续受到关注,具备较强的未来发展潜力。选择这样的编程语言可以增加你的职业机会。